
Color-Blocked-and-Seamed Scarf
Introducing a stunning 5-color blocked garter stitch scarf, crafted from the center out and featuring innovative short rows. This unique design allows you to combine vibrant hues while ensuring a cozy wrap that’s perfect for any season. Once completed, the two halves of the scarf are seamlessly joined in the middle using a crochet hook, resulting in a beautifully finished piece. To enhance the richness of the colors, you will hold two strands of each color together while knitting the scarf, adding depth and texture to your project.
This scarf is designed to be versatile, and you can choose from Sock/Fingering Weight yarns or opt for single strands of DK or Worsted Weight yarns for a more substantial, warmer scarf. This makes it a fantastic choice for both elegant spring outings and colder winter days!
Materials: For this project, we recommend using Sock/Fingering Weight Yarn. Our favorite choice is Wonderland Yarns “Cheshire Cat,” made from 100% superwash merino. You will be using the captivating colors from the Gyre and Gimble collection.
Requirement: You will need 2 Mini-skein packs of 5 coordinating colors. Each pack should contain the same colors, totaling 128 yards per 1 oz skein. In total, you'll require 10 skeins, equating to a generous 1280 yards of gorgeous yarn.
Needle Size: We recommend using US 5/3.75mm 24” (61cm) circular needles to achieve the desired drape and flow in your fabric.
Gauge: The ideal gauge for this project is 22 stitches and 25 rows to 4" when knit using US 5/3.75mm in garter stitch, ensuring that your scarf has the perfect fit and feel.
